@Maria_Hernandez if you want help you will have to put more effort into describing the problem. These are universally-applicable requirements for getting help with any program, all points equally important:

  1. Always provide the exact version of the program in question, your operating system, and RAM. (provided)
  2. Accurately describe the problem. “It does not work” and “it crashes” are too vague.
  3. Describe the steps to reproduce the problem.
  4. If relevant, provide an uncropped screenshot, and sample files.
